Canada has conducted a new Express Entry draw, issuing 300 Invitations to Apply to candidates with French-language proficiency. The October 25 draw featured a minimum Comprehensive Ranking System score of 486, 14 points higher than the previous draw aimed at French-speakers. Canada has issued 1,548 Invitations to Apply in a new Express Entry draw aimed at Provincial Nominee Program candidates. The October 24 draw featured a minimum Comprehensive Ranking System score of 776.
